Healthy Communities Coalition and Community Roots are proud to team up with Lyon County School District in providing gardens in almost every school in the county with a goal 100% school garden participation in Lyon County by 2018.

These gardens feature hoop houses which are "low tech greenhouses" that extend the growing season, as well as outdoor gardens to keep the food supply growing during the summer and fall months.

Children are taught by teachers, farmers and school interns in the process of planting, maintaining and harvesting food for their schools.  School gardens are an innovative way to educated our youth about helping sustain themselves and sustain our planet.
